QUICK CHICKEN KIEV



Quick Chicken Kiev image

"I make these pretty chicken breasts all the time and just love the taste," writes Dorothy LaCombe of Hamburg, New York. "Because they're microwaved, they're ready to serve in no time."

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Time 30m

Yield 4 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 9

5 tablespoons butter, softened, divided
1/2 teaspoon minced chives
1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
1/4 teaspoon white pepper
4 boneless skinless chicken breast halves (6 ounces each)
1/3 cup cornflake crumbs
1 tablespoon grated Parmesan cheese
1/2 teaspoon dried parsley flakes
1/4 teaspoon paprika

Steps:

  • In a small bowl, combine 3 tablespoons butter, chives, garlic powder and pepper; shape into four cubes. Cover and freeze until firm, about 10 minutes. , Flatten chicken breast halves to 1/4-in. thickness. Place a butter cube in the center of each. Fold long sides over butter; fold ends up and secure with a toothpick. , In a shallow bowl, combine the cornflakes, Parmesan cheese, parsley and paprika. Melt remaining butter. Dip chicken into butter; coat evenly with cornflake mixture. Place seam side down in a microwave-safe dish. , Microwave, uncovered, on high for 5-6 minutes or until chicken juices run clear and a thermometer reads 170°. Remove toothpicks. Drizzle chicken with pan drippings if desired.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 265 calories, Fat 12g fat (6g saturated fat), Cholesterol 120mg cholesterol, Sodium 215mg sodium, Carbohydrate 4g carbohydrate (0 sugars, Fiber 0 fiber), Protein 36g protein.

CHEF JOHN'S CHICKEN KIEV



Chef John's Chicken Kiev image

I'm not going to say this chicken Kiev is 'easy to make.' It's really not. So, why try? Because, if and when you pull this off, you'll be enjoying one of the greatest chicken experiences of your life. It's also one of the greatest garlic experiences of your life, as well as one of the greatest butter experiences of your life.

Provided by Chef John

Categories     Meat and Poultry Recipes     Chicken     Chicken Breast Recipes

Time 1h35m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 12

2 cloves garlic, minced
1 pinch salt
2 tablespoons chopped fresh flat-leaf parsley
6 tablespoons unsalted butter
4 (8 ounce) skinless, boneless chicken breast halves, pounded to 1/4-inch thickness
salt and pepper to taste
1 cup all-purpose flour
2 teaspoons salt
2 eggs, beaten
2 cups panko bread crumbs
1 pinch cayenne pepper
2 cups vegetable oil for frying, or as needed

Steps:

  • Grind garlic and a pinch of salt together in a mortar and pestle until garlic is completely smashed. Add parsley and mix until completely incorporated. Pound butter into garlic mixture with pestle until parsley and garlic are fully incorporated into the butter. Wrap the butter mixture in plastic wrap and refrigerate until cold, at least 15 minutes.
  • Season chicken breasts with salt and pepper. Place 1/4 the butter mixture in the center of wider end of each chicken breast. Fold the narrower end of each chicken breast up over the butter to form a tight pocket around the butter. Gather the sides of each chicken breast to the center to form a round ball. The top of the chicken will be smooth and the bottom will be gathered. Tightly wrap each chicken breast ball in plastic wrap, put wrapped breasts on a plate, and chill in the freezer until the gathered bottoms hold together and are slightly firm, about 30 minutes.
  • Whisk flour and 2 teaspoons salt together in a shallow bowl. Whisk eggs together in another shallow bowl. Pour panko bread crumbs into another bowl.
  • Remove chicken breast balls from plastic wrap. Gently press each chicken breast ball into flour mixture to coat and shake off any excess flour. Dip into beaten eggs, then press into bread crumbs. Place breaded chicken onto a plate, cover with plastic wrap, and return to the freezer to chill until firm, about 15 minutes.
  • Heat oil in a deep-fryer or large saucepan to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C). Line a baking sheet with aluminum foil.
  • Working in batches, cook chicken, gathered-side down, in hot oil and until lightly golden on both sides, about 1 minute per side. Transfer to prepared baking sheet. Sprinkle salt and cayenne pepper over the top.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until you can hear the butter start to sizzle on the baking sheet, 15 to 17 minutes. An instant-read thermometer inserted into the center should read at least 165 degrees F (74 degrees C). Let rest for 5 minutes before serving.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 790.3 calories, Carbohydrate 62.2 g, Cholesterol 268 mg, Fat 38.3 g, Fiber 1 g, Protein 59.5 g, SaturatedFat 15.3 g, Sodium 1656 mg, Sugar 0.3 g

EASY CHICKEN KIEV (BAKED)



Easy Chicken Kiev (Baked) image

There's a few recipes on Zaar for this, but this one seems different from the rest, even though some ingredients are the same. This is simple and delicious. Prep time includes 30 minutes to freeze.

Provided by CulinaryQueen

Categories     Chicken

Time 1h20m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 10

4 boneless skinless chicken breasts
2 garlic cloves, finely minced
1 lemon, zest of
1 teaspoon lemon juice
4 ounces butter, softened
1 tablespoon parsley, chopped (fresh if possible)
salt and pepper, to taste
2 tablespoons flour
1 egg, beaten
1/3 cup breadcrumbs

Steps:

  • Beat the chicken breasts flat with a meat mallet or a rolling pin.
  • Mix together the garlic, lemon rind, lemon juice, butter, parsley, salt and pepper to form a paste.
  • Divide the butter evenly between the chicken breasts and carefully roll up and secure with string.
  • Freeze for 15 minutes or until the butter is firm.
  • Coat the chicken in the flour, dip in the beaten egg and coat in the breadcrumbs, pressing firmly to make sure they stick.
  • Return to the freezer for a further 15 minutes.
  • Preheat oven to 190C/375°F.
  • Bake the chicken for 30-40 minutes or until the outside is golden and crisp.
  • Plate the chicken and drizzle a bit of the butter sauce over it before serving.

DELICIOUS BAKED CHICKEN KIEV



Delicious Baked Chicken Kiev image

This is the BEST! I was raised on this, and it is the best chicken Kiev you'll ever have. After you make it a few times it's a snap. I do this by memory. You can adjust the flavors to taste. This recipe tastes great as leftovers also!

Provided by Jessica

Categories     Meat and Poultry Recipes     Chicken     Chicken Breast Recipes

Time 1h

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 10

¼ cup butter, softened
⅛ teaspoon garlic powder
1 tablespoon chopped fresh parsley
5 cups honey-sweetened corn flake cereal
3 tablespoons chopped fresh parsley
1 ½ teaspoons garlic powder
1 teaspoon paprika
1 teaspoon salt
6 skinless, boneless chicken breast halves - pounded to 1/4 inch thickness
¼ cup buttermilk

Steps:

  • In a small bowl, stir together the butter, 1/8 teaspoon garlic powder, and 1 tablespoon of parsley. Spread the butter mixture 1/2 inch thick onto a piece of aluminum foil, and place in the freezer to harden.
  • Place the cereal in a large plastic resealable bag, and crush with a rolling pin. Add the remaining parsley, 1 1/2 teaspoons garlic powder, paprika and salt, seal the bag, and shake to mix.
  •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C). Grease a 9x13 inch baking dish.
  • Remove the slab of butter mixture from the freezer, and slice into 6 strips. Place one strip onto the center of each pounded chicken breast, roll up and secure with toothpicks. Dip rolled chicken breasts into buttermilk, then into the cereal mixture. Place coated breasts into the prepared baking dish.
  • Bake, uncovered, for 30 to 40 minutes until chicken is no longer pink, and the juices run clear. The outside should be crispy and golden.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 330.7 calories, Carbohydrate 30.9 g, Cholesterol 89.2 mg, Fat 9.6 g, Fiber 1.3 g, Protein 29.8 g, SaturatedFat 5.3 g, Sodium 820.8 mg, Sugar 13.1 g

CHICKEN KIEV



Chicken Kiev image

This fantastic Russian Chicken Kiev recipe has been my family favorite for the past 30 years. It is reasonably easy to prepare and is worth the time.

Provided by William Anatooskin

Categories     World Cuisine Recipes     European     Eastern European     Russian

Time 1h2m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 14

⅓ cup butter
½ teaspoon ground black pepper
1 teaspoon garlic powder
2 pounds skinless, boneless chicken breast halves
2 eggs
3 tablespoons water
¼ teaspoon ground black pepper
½ teaspoon garlic powder
1 teaspoon dried dill weed
¾ cup all-purpose flour
¾ cup dry bread crumbs
2 cups vegetable oil for frying
½ lemon, sliced
¼ cup chopped fresh parsley

Steps:

  • Combine 1/3 cup butter, 1/2 teaspoon pepper and 1 teaspoon garlic powder. On a 6x6 inch piece of aluminum foil, spread mixture to about 2x3 inches. Place this mixture in the coldest section of your freezer and freeze until firm. This can be done ahead of time.
  • Remove all fat from the chicken breast. If using whole chicken breasts, cut them in half. Place each chicken breast half between 2 pieces of waxed paper and using a mallet, pound carefully to about 1/4 inch thickness or less.
  • When butter mixture is firm, remove from freezer and cut into 6 equal pieces. Place one piece of butter on each chicken breast. Fold in edges of chicken and then roll to encase the butter completely. Secure the chicken roll with small skewers or toothpicks.
  • In a mixing bowl, beat eggs with water until fluffy. In a separate bowl, mix together 1/4 teaspoon black pepper, 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der, dill weed and flour. Coat the chicken well with the seasoned flour. Dip the floured chicken in the egg mixture and then roll in the bread crumbs. Place coated chicken on a shallow tray and chill in refrigerator for 30 minutes.
  • In a medium size deep frying pan, heat vegetable oil to medium-high. Fry chicken for about 5 minutes then turn over and fry for 5 minutes longer or until the chicken is golden brown. To test for doneness, cut into one of the rolled chicken breasts to make sure it doesn't have a pink interior. Serve immediately, garnished with a sliced lemon twist and a sprinkling or parsley.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 485 calories, Carbohydrate 24.2 g, Cholesterol 181.1 mg, Fat 24.9 g, Fiber 1.7 g, Protein 39.9 g, SaturatedFat 9.4 g, Sodium 304 mg, Sugar 1.2 g

EASY CHICKEN KIEV RECIPE (VIDEO) - NATASHASKITCHEN.COM
easy-chicken-kiev-recipe-video-natashaskitchencom image
2017-02-28 Dredge chicken in flour, dusting off excess then dip in eggs making sure to get a good egg coating all around and letting any excess egg drip off. Finally dip into the bread crumbs. Transfer to a platter while forming remaining chicken …
From natashaskitchen.com
  • In a medium bowl, mash together all Kiev butter ingredients with a fork, just until lemon juice is incorporated into the butter. It takes a couple mins but it does come together.
  • Using a sharp slim knife, cut chicken breasts in half lengthwise, keeping both halves equal in size and thickness. Carefully cut a pocket into the side of each chicken breast as deep and wide as you can go without cutting through the chicken breast (about a 2"x3" pocket). Stuff each chicken breast with 1 Tbsp of Kiev butter then close the pocket and push over the top of chicken breast to disperse butter. Pinch the opening to seal. Season both sides of chicken breast with salt and pepper.
  • Dredge chicken in flour, dusting off excess then dip in eggs making sure to get a good egg coating all around and letting any excess egg drip off. Finally dip into the bread crumbs. Transfer to a platter while forming remaining chicken Kievs.
  • Add 1/3" of oil to a large deep skillet and place over medium heat. Once the oil is hot (a bread crumb should sizzle when you add it to the pan), add chicken in a single layer and fry until golden brown (4 min per side). Repeat with second batch. Season hot fried chicken with a sprinkle of salt, garnish with fresh parsley, and squeeze lemon wedges over the top then serve. Be careful of the first spurt of hot butter when you cut the chicken.

CHICKEN KIEVS RECIPE | DELICIOUS. MAGAZINE
2012-02-29 Divide evenly among the flattened chicken breasts, then bring the edges of the chicken over the butter to form a neat parcel with the seam on top. Invert onto a plate or board, so the seal is underneath, then chill for 10 minutes. Preheat the oven to 200°C/fan180°C/gas 6. Dust each Kiev …
From deliciousmagazine.co.uk
5/5 (3)
Category Comfort Food
Servings 4
Total Time 45 mins
  • In a bowl, mix together the butter, garlic and parsley. Season well, then spoon onto a sheet of cling film. Shape into a log (about 10cm x 4cm) and freeze for 15 minutes until solid.
  • Meanwhile, put the chicken breasts between 2 pieces of cling film and bash with a rolling pin until completely flattened. Take the butter from the freezer and slice into thin rounds. Divide evenly among the flattened chicken breasts, then bring the edges of the chicken over the butter to form a neat parcel with the seam on top. Invert onto a plate or board, so the seal is underneath, then chill for 10 minutes.
  • Preheat the oven to 200°C/fan180°C/gas 6. Dust each Kiev in seasoned flour, then dip in the egg, followed by the breadcrumbs. Make sure they’re well coated.
  • Heat a generous layer of oil in a non-stick frying pan over a medium-high heat. Put the Kievs in the pan, with the seal underneath, and fry for 5-7 minutes, turning to brown all over. Transfer to a baking sheet and bake for 12-15 minutes. Serve with mashed potato or a green salad.
